I'm gonna be brief, I never wanted to use the new Reddit interface and always stuck to Old Reddit. Recently, it has been decided that logging in would be mandatory to use old reddit, another step further to try and smother it, to force people to go to the new shittier and more ad friendly interface. The days of old reddit are numbered, and one day they will pull the plug for good. If I can't use Old Reddit, then I will not use Reddit at all, which means I need a new place on the web to discuss RPGs.

Where are the other big RPG communities on the internet? Some friends of mine have suggested Discord, but I always felt that it was better for casual chat than long and in depth conversations, and debates. Also I vetoed places such as RPG NET because of their adversarial, and downright user hostile approach of moderation.

Lots of games have dedicated Discord communities, and all the ones I'm in are lovely.

Paper Cult Club is an indie-focused forum with a lot of designers. The Piazza discusses old D&D settings.

There are some groups on Facebook, but that is a shitty site too. And sure, Discord has plenty of server, but there indeed gets too much lost in the shuffle, especially on the larger servers. My suggestion would be blogs, those allow for in-depth exploration of the topics and personal discussion with the bloggers. But the difficulty is too find the people you are really vibing with.
